US78 appears to start at the US64/70/79 duplex at 2nd/3rd St on Dr Martin Luther King Jr Ave. It runs along Dr Martin Luther King Jr Ave to East St and follows that to E H Crump Blvd. When that turns into Lamar Ave, then the route follows as shown in the highway browser.

As I mentioned in the US-64/70/79 thread, route was based off the old city maps from TDOT dated from 2002 before StreetView.

I've verified US-78 going onto East St per StreetView, and see that it can't stay on Dr Martin Luther King Jr Ave/South Somerville St as when it gets to "TN4_W" since there is a grass divider.

So, US-78 will be fixed in my next TN update.
